Styx Branch
Stream in Sevier County, Tennessee U.S. From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
Styx Branch is a stream in Sevier County, Tennessee in the United States.[1]
The stream headwaters are at 35°39′03″N 83°26′01″W and its confluence with Alum Cave Creek is at 35°38′02″N 83°26′18″W.[1][2] The stream source is on the south flank of Mount Le Conte at approximate elevation of 5600 feet and the confluence elevation is 4117 feet.[1][2]
The stream was named after the river Styx, in Greek mythology.[3]
